Published May 2002
WASHINGTON -
The General Services Administration broke ground on the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co and Firearms' 422,000-sf Northeast Washington headquarters on April 10. Slated for completion in 2004, the $103-million project is aimed to revitalize the eastern corridor of the city. The facility will house 1,100 government employees.
